2025: All-Summit League First Team, Summit League Tournament MVP and All-Tournament Team selection … 2025 Team Captain … started 21 games for the Jackrabbits during her senior season … totaled eight points on one goal and six assists … competed a team-high 1,770 minutes … played the full 90 minutes 15 times, the most of anyone in the squad … tied for sixth in The Summit League with six assists … second on the team in assists (6) and tied for tenth in program single-season history … tied for fifth in the squad in shots on goal (11) … her minutes played were the 22nd most in a season by a Jackrabbit … one multi-point game on the backline, picking up two assists against St. Thomas (Sept. 25) … scored lone goal of the season against North Dakota (Oct. 2) … eight game streak where she played every minute of every match (Oct. 19 – Nov. 9) … played every minute of the Summit League Tournament where the Jacks’ did not let in a single goal … anchored a defense that posted 11 shutouts throughout the year and led The Summit League in goals against average (0.68) … honored with several accolades at the close of the season … was selected as a Second Team All-West Region performer by United Soccer Coaches … a standout in the classroom having already obtained two bachelor’s degrees (business economics and accounting) and in the midst of graduate school (economics) … SDSU’s lone member on the conference’s Academic All-League Team … was named a 2025 Academic All-American by the College Sports Communicators organization … a Second Team honoree, just fourth Academic All-American in program history, and first since 2022 … finished her college career with 10 assists (19th most in SDSU history) and competed for 4,943 minutes (top 30 individually).
2024: Served as team captain as a junior … played in all 22 matches and started in 21 coming off season-ending injury in 2023 … primarily played from the back line but also appeared in defensive midfield … competed for fourth most minutes on team (1,584) which was a career high total … also recorded career highs in shots (22) and shots on goal (6) … scored a goal on a free kick in a Sept. 1 victory at Green Bay … had assists in matches versus St. Thomas (Oct. 6) and South Dakota (Oct. 11) … selected as Summit League Peak Defensive Performer of the Week on Oct. 7 following a pair of SDSU shutout victories … an honorable mention to the All-Summit League Team … recognized for efforts in classroom in multiple places … named to The Summit League’s Academic All-League Team … a College Sports Communicators Academic All-District choice.
2023: Served as a starter in the first 10 matches of season … played a mix of defense and midfield for the Jackrabbits … registered 12 shots with five on goals for a .417 shots on goal percentage … recorded an assist in SDSU’s Aug. 19 win over Augustana … competed for full 90 minutes at Utah State (Sept. 1) and versus Grand Canyon (Sept. 7) … had just one game in which she played less than 70 minutes … season ended due to leg injury during Sept. 24 match at South Dakota.
2022: Played in all 19 matches and started in four as a freshman … competed over 40 minutes in 10 games including a season high 71 versus Creighton on Sept. 11 … had first assist of career in match that ended in 1-1 tie … scored first career goal and had season-high three shots in Oct. 7 match at St. Thomas … had a goal by header in Oct. 9 game at Western Illinois … finished season with five points … had a .263 shots on goal percentage behind 19 shots … named to The Summit League All-Newcomer Team.
Background: Graduated from White Bear Lake Area High School in 2022 … accumulated 31 goals and 28 assists during her prep career … was tabbed first team all-state in 2021 tallying 12 goals and 11 assists her senior season … an all-conference selection all four seasons of her high school career and was a second team all-state choice as a junior … helped lead the White Bears to a 2019 conference championship and a section runner-up finish in 2021 … a three-sport standout at White Bear Lake … played basketball and ran track for the White Bears … was a 4.0 GPA student, 2021 AP Scholar and National Honor Society member.
